Nettet19. jan. 2024 · One way to get there is by right-clicking the Start button and selecting Settings, but you can also use your keyboard via WIN+i . Navigate to Bluetooth & devices > Printers & scanners. Select Add device, wait a few seconds for Windows to locate the printer, and then select Add device next to the one you want to install. Nettet26. mar. 2016 · Choose Start→Devices and Printers. Windows 7 presents you with the Device Stage. Double-click the device name you want to pin to your taskbar. The Devices and Printers service page for that device will appear and the device’s icon should temporarily appear on the Windows taskbar. Right-click the device’s icon and (if the …
